Just came back from a trip with my son. While was driving his scooter I had plenty of time to think about my problem again. I think I'm onto something really stupid.
I'll do some tests later, because I guess it is not
readfile(). Thanks for the heads up for now.
Edit/update:
It's not
readfile(), it was my stupid brain.
It is not
all variables as it first seemed to be. After I wrote a lot of debug messages into a file it's left to
<br> - which is the default linebreaker in
msg(). This deserves a very loud OUCH!
Background: I'm setting a up a rather long script/function collection to automatically create (or compare existing) VSCode (and Atom) snippets for XYplorer. The first source is idh_scripting_comref.htm from XYplorer.chm (extracted with 7zip), from which the relevant sections get parsed, followed by a series of html entity replacements, followed by another series of regex-based guesses on the nature of params (strings vs. numbers/booleans), followed by .......
Somewhere down this road I obviously confused myself ...
Thanks again for help - and understanding.
